Comprehending the IELTS Test

The IELTS test is developed to evaluate the language skills of prospects in 4 areas: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. There are two variations of the test: Academic and General Training. The Academic version appropriates for those who want to study at a greater education level or look for professional registration, while the General Training version is for those who are migrating to an English-speaking nation or looking for work experience.

Preparing for the IELTS Test

  1. Listening

    • Practice Listening: Listen to a variety of English audio materials, such as podcasts, news broadcasts, and lectures.
    • Take Practice Tests: Use main IELTS practice tests to simulate the test environment.
    • Note-Taking: Develop your note-taking abilities to catch key details quickly.
  2. Reading

    • Check out Widely: Read a series of texts, including academic posts, newspapers, and books.
    • Time Management: Practice reading and answering concerns within the time limitation.
    • Comprehension: Focus on comprehending the main points and supporting details.
  3. Composing

    • Task 1 (Academic): Practice composing reports based on charts, charts, and diagrams.
    • Task 1 (General Training): Practice composing letters for various functions.
    • Task 2: Practice composing essays on different subjects.
    • Feedback: Seek feedback from teachers or peers to improve your writing.
  4. Speaking

    • Practice Speaking: Engage in discussions with native English speakers or use language exchange platforms.
    • Mock Interviews: Participate in mock IELTS speaking tests to develop confidence.
    • Pronunciation and Fluency: Focus on enhancing your pronunciation and speaking with complete confidence.
